Career path
| Career Role (Energy Systems Emergency Preparedness) | Description |
|---|---|
| Energy Systems Emergency Response Manager | Leads and coordinates emergency response teams, ensuring efficient and effective incident management within energy systems. High demand for expertise in crisis management and regulatory compliance. |
| Renewable Energy Emergency Technician | Specializes in the rapid restoration of renewable energy sources post-emergency, incorporating preventative maintenance and resilient design principles. Growing sector with excellent future prospects. |
| Energy Infrastructure Resilience Specialist | Analyzes energy infrastructure vulnerabilities and develops strategies to enhance resilience against natural disasters and cyber threats. Critical role for ensuring national grid security. |
| Grid Emergency Control Operator | Monitors and controls power grids during emergencies, prioritizing stability and minimizing disruptions. Requires strong technical skills and the ability to work under pressure. |
| Emergency Power Systems Engineer | Designs, installs, and maintains backup power systems for critical facilities, ensuring uninterrupted power supply during emergencies. In-demand role with strong salary potential. |
